Great opportunity exists for an aged care leader to join The Salvation Army as the Aged Care Centre Manager, who is committed to best care outcomes for our residents at Barrington Lodge Aged Care Centre. We provide award winning, person-centered emotional, spiritual and physical care for older Australians to enjoy.
Barrington Lodge is a 77 bed Aged Care Centre. Built in 1850, the lodge is rich in history and provides a cosy, comfortable home with mountain and park views. The centre is conveniently located with access to public transport and is only 2 minutes' drive to the New Town Plaza and local services.
ABOUT THE ROLE
As the Aged Care Centre Manager with The Salvation Army you will be responsible for the operational management of the centre, supported closely by a Clinical Care Manager and a multidisciplinary team of care staff, including RNs, CSEs, Lifestyle, etc.
Areas of responsibility include compliance, staff management, financial management, occupancy and AN-ACC elements to support the needs of our residents. You will report to and be supported by your Sydney based Area Manager and you'll collaborate with our Support Services team and specialist professionals in aged care.
